It's a bit more complicated than just K03, K04 etc. Borg warner/kkk's clasification system is pretty complicated, compressor wheels are identified by a 4 digit number. the first 2 are the exducer size in 10th's of an inch, the seccond 2 are the size of the inducer given in a percentage of the exducer, for example a 2275 wheel has a 2.2" exducer, 1.65" inducer (75% of 2.2) ! Heres a breif rundown of the differences between the turbos most people fit to their mk4's:
K03-K03s differences, K03 has a 2073 compressor wheel, K03s has a bigger/better 2075 wheel, exhaust side is exactly the same. (same turbine, same 22mm wastegate)
K04-001 - similar 2075 compressor wheel as the K03s, slightly larger turbine, larger wastegate, direct replacement for the K03/K03s
K04-02x - 2275 compressor wheel, larger turbine than the K04-001, will not fit a mk4 without buying a different exhaust manifold, downpipe, tip etc.
There are literally hundreds of different variations of K series turbo's.
